Course Description

Students of media literacy apply critical thinking skills in analyzing the source of much of our information: the media. The emphasis in media literacy consists of the following areas of study: an awareness of the impact of the media on the individual and society; an understanding of the process of mass communication; the development of critical approaches with which to analyze and discuss media messages; an awareness of media content as a “text” that provides insight into our contemporary culture and ourselves; an awareness of the depiction of diverse groups within a culture by the media; and the cultivation of an enhanced enjoyment, understanding, and appreciation of media content.

Career outcomes

Successful graduates of this program will be able to: * demonstrate comprehension and knowledge of basic media literacy concepts; * use industry-standard terms and concepts in communicating media literacy ideas; * apply media literacy concepts to a variety of media; * express media literacy concepts and develop arguments in writing; * conduct original media literacy research; * analyze and synthesize media literacy concepts; * evaluate application of media literacy concepts.
